Conector do Google BigQuery¶
Resumo¶
O Harmony Google BigQuery Connector estabelece acesso ao Google BigQuery.
O conector do Google BigQuery fornece uma interface para criar uma conexão do Google BigQuery, a base usada para gerar instâncias de atividades do Google BigQuery. Essas atividades, uma vez configuradas, interagem com o Google BigQuery por meio da conexão.
O conector do Google BigQuery é acessado na aba Conexões da paleta de componentes de design (consulte Paleta de Componentes de Design).
Visão Geral do Conector¶
Este conector é usado para configurar primeiro uma conexão do Google BigQuery. Os tipos de atividades associados a essa conexão são então usados para criar instâncias de atividades que se destinam a serem usadas como origens (para fornecer dados em uma operação) ou destinos (para consumir dados em uma operação).
Juntos, uma conexão específica do Google BigQuery e suas atividades são chamadas de endpoint do Google BigQuery:
-
Transferência de dados: Transfere dados de uma fonte de dados para um conjunto de dados no Google BigQuery e deve ser usado como destino em uma operação.
-
Invocar Rotina: Invoca uma rotina (como um procedimento armazenado, uma função definida pelo usuário ou uma função de tabela) para um conjunto de dados no Google BigQuery e deve ser usado como destino em uma operação.
-
Consulta: Consulta uma tabela em um conjunto de dados no Google BigQuery e destina-se a ser usado como origem em uma operação.
-
Inserir registro: Insere registros em uma tabela no Google BigQuery e deve ser usado como destino em uma operação.
-
Criar Estrutura: Cria conjuntos de dados ou tabelas no Google BigQuery e deve ser usado como destino em uma operação.
-
Estrutura de atualização: Atualiza estruturas no Google BigQuery e deve ser usado como destino em uma operação.
-
Atualizar registro: Atualiza registros em um conjunto de dados no Google BigQuery e deve ser usado como destino em uma operação.
-
Excluir estrutura: Exclui estruturas do Google BigQuery e deve ser usado como destino em uma operação.
-
Executar consulta personalizada: Executa consultas personalizadas em tabelas em conjuntos de dados no Google BigQuery e deve ser usado como origem em uma operação.
Nota
Este conector é um SDK do conector, que pode ser referido pelo Jitterbit ao comunicar alterações feitas em conectores criados com o Connector SDK.
Pré-requisitos e Versões de API Suportadas¶
O conector do Google BigQuery requer o uso de uma versão do agente 10.1 ou mais tarde. Essas versões do agente baixam automaticamente a versão mais recente do conector quando necessário.
O conector do Google BigQuery usa o Google SDK versão 25.4.0. Consulte a documentação do SDK para obter informações sobre os nós e campos do esquema.
Para usar o conector do Google BigQuery, você deve ter uma conta de serviço do Google para seu projeto com as permissões apropriadas definidas e determinadas credenciais obtidas da conta de serviço (conforme descrito em Pré-requisitos do Google BigQuery).
Solução de Problemas¶
Se você tiver problemas com o conector do Google BigQuery, recomendamos estas etapas de solução de problemas:
-
Clique no botão Testar na configuração da conexão para garantir que a conexão seja bem-sucedida e garantir que a versão mais recente do conector seja baixada para o agente (a menos que você use a Desativar atualização automática do conector política da organização).
-
Verifique os logs de operação para qualquer informação escrita durante a execução da operação.
-
Habilite o registro de depurar de operação (para Agentes em Nuvem ou para Agentes Privados) para gerar arquivos de log e dados adicionais.
-
Se estiver usando Agentes Privados, você pode ativar registro detalhado do conector para este conector usando esta entrada de configuração específica de nome e nível do criador de logs:
<logger name="org.jitterbit.connector.google.bigquery" level="DEBUG"/>
-
Se estiver usando Agentes Privados, você pode verificar os logs do agente Para maiores informações.